Seraphine is currently the #2962 girl name in the United States — 56 babies received it in 2025. A decade ago it stood at #5288, so the name has been rising over the past ten years. Roughly one in every 32,143 girls born in 2025 was named Seraphine.

The 133-year story

Seraphine first appears in the Social Security records in 1892, when 7 girls received the name. Its all-time peak is essentially right now: 2025, with 56 babies and a rank of #2957. Where Seraphine is most common

State-level data for Seraphine is too sparse in 2025 to rank by rate — in most states its count falls below the SSA's per-state reporting threshold (counts under 5 are withheld).
